What Makes a Neighborhood Desirable?

Before diving into the importance of location, it’s essential to understand what qualities make a neighborhood desirable. Here are a few key factors to consider when determining the desirability of a neighborhood:

Safety and Security

One of the most crucial aspects of a desirable neighborhood is its level of safety and security. This not only applies to the crime rate but also includes factors such as well-lit streets, maintained sidewalks, and neighborly watchfulness. A safe and secure neighborhood can provide peace of mind for residents, especially for families with children.

Proximity to Essential Amenities

Living in a neighborhood that offers convenient access to essential amenities is highly desirable. These amenities include grocery stores, schools, parks, hospitals, and public transportation. Having all these facilities within the vicinity of your neighborhood can save you time, money, and hassle, making it a highly desirable location.

Diversity and Multi-Functionality

An ideal neighborhood is diverse in terms of housing options, from single-family homes to apartments, condominiums, and townhouses. The community should also consist of residents from diverse backgrounds, cultures, and age groups. A multi-functional neighborhood offers a balanced mix of residential properties, retail and commercial spaces, as well as recreational areas.

The Impact of Location on Your Daily Life

Now that we’ve established the qualities of a desirable neighborhood, let’s take a closer look at how the power of location can affect your daily life:

Commute Time and Cost

Living in a desirable neighborhood means that you’re likely to be closer to your workplace or have easy access to public transportation. This can significantly reduce your daily commute time, leading to less stress and more time to spend with loved ones. Additionally, a shorter commute can also mean saving money on transportation costs, which can add up over time.

Property Appreciation

The location of a property has a significant impact on its value and potential for appreciation. Homes in highly desirable neighborhoods tend to appreciate in value faster than those in less desirable areas. This is because a great location is a finite resource that cannot be duplicated, making it a sought-after commodity in the real estate market.

Social and Cultural Opportunities

Living in a desirable neighborhood can provide residents with a sense of community and belonging. It’s easier to connect with like-minded individuals and participate in social and cultural activities when you live in an area with a diverse and vibrant community. This can enhance your overall wellbeing and quality of life.

Choosing the Right Neighborhood

Now that we understand the power of location and its impact on daily life, it’s essential to know how to choose the right neighborhood for you. Here are a few tips:

Research, Research, Research

Before committing to a neighborhood, it’s crucial to research thoroughly. Visit the area and take note of its amenities, safety, and overall appeal. Additionally, look into the demographics and local schools to determine if it’s a good fit for your lifestyle.

Consider Your Needs

Think about your needs and priorities before choosing a neighborhood. For example, if you have children, you may prioritize being close to schools and parks. If you value a vibrant social scene, consider a neighborhood with bars, restaurants, and cultural events.

Consult with a Real Estate Professional

A real estate professional can provide valuable insight into different neighborhoods and help you find the right one for your lifestyle and budget. They can also advise you on market trends and potential for property appreciation.
